Hi Reza, thank you for this incredibly detailed tutorial, I learned so much just by following the step by step tutorial. I modified the component by adding a MenuState output property that points to showMenu variable and in the component height property I'm using If(MenuLeftNav.MenuState,App.ActiveScreen.Height,50), that way when the menu is not pressed the Hamburger menu just minimizes to the icon size. I had to do this because even with the slim width when component is not active it was interfering with my app layout. I did however have an issue where the submenu items were getting set to a height of 1 when I import the component into my main app, undoubtedly due to changes in PowerApps since this video was made. I fixed this by hard coding the TemplateSize of the galSubMenu to the size I wanted instead of using the code shown in the video. This makes it to where the submenu items do not get set to a height of 1 when importing. Just in case anyone else runs into this issue and needs a quick fix.

Hello, thanks for this excellent video. In the table menu I want one of the options to be a link to an internet site and not to another screen of the application, how can I do that?
You would need to update the component. There is a function called Launch which will allow you to open links. You will also need to update the input property for component to distinguish between screen references and links.

Awesome video, Reza ! However, I want to share that I encountered a small challenge. Initially, my 'Navigate' command didn't work. After some hours of troubleshooting, I realized that the data in the 'MenuScreenNavigate' field shouldn't be enclosed in quotation marks. I hope this can be helpful to someone facing the same issue.
